Yard leveling services involve adjusting the grade of a property's landscape to create a smooth, even surface. This process typically includes removing excess soil, filling in low spots, and reshaping the land to ensure proper drainage and stability. Proper yard leveling can help prevent issues like water pooling, soil erosion, and uneven ground that can make outdoor spaces difficult to use or maintain. By working with experienced local contractors, homeowners can achieve a yard that looks uniform and functions effectively for activities, landscaping, or future construction projects.
Many common problems prompt homeowners to seek yard leveling services. These include uneven ground caused by settling, heavy rain, or poor initial grading, which can lead to water runoff and potential flooding in certain areas. An unlevel yard can also cause tripping hazards, damage to lawns, or difficulties with installing features like patios, driveways, or fences. Addressing these issues through professional yard leveling can improve safety, enhance curb appeal, and help maintain the integrity of the landscape over time.

The overview below groups typical Yard Leveling proj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Crossville, TN.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or yard leveling jobs in Crossville range from $250 to $600. Many routine repairs fall within this band, especially for small areas or minor adjustments.
Mid-Size Projects - More extensive yard leveling services, such as correcting larger uneven areas, usually cost between $600 and $1,500. These projects are common for homeowners seeking a noticeable improvement.
Large-Scale Repairs - Larger or more complex yard leveling projects can range from $1,500 to $3,500, especially when significant grading or soil removal is involved. Fewer projects push into this higher tier.
Full Replacement or Major Overhaul - Complete yard leveling or extensive landscape regrading can exceed $3,500, with some projects reaching $5,000 or more. These are typically less frequent but necessary for substantial terrain modification.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
